Detailed Solution

Assertion (A): "Sarcomere gets shortened during muscle contraction."

This statement is correct. The sarcomere, which is the basic contractile unit of a muscle, shortens during muscle contraction. This shortening occurs due to the sliding of actin and myosin filaments over each other.

Reason (R): "‘Z’ line attached to the actins are pushed outwards during contraction."

This statement is not accurate. During muscle contraction, the 'Z' lines (Z-discs) actually move closer together, not outwards. The sliding of actin and myosin filaments causes the sarcomere to contract, bringing the Z-discs closer.
